What companies run services between Rennes, France and Parma, Italy?

You can take a train from Rennes to Parma via Paris Montparnasse 1 Et 2, Montparnasse Bienvenue, Quai de la Gare, Paris Gare De Lyon, and Milano Centrale in around 12h 22m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Rennes to Parma via Paris in around 18h 55m.
